【基于 FPGA 的点阵显示屏设计】是这篇毕业论文的核心主题,主要探讨了如何利用 FPGA(Field-Programmable Gate Array,现场可编程门阵列)技术来设计一款16×16点阵LED显示屏。FPGA是一种可编程的集成电路,能根据设计需求配置成不同的逻辑功能,常用于数字信号处理和系统级集成。 论文详细阐述了设计过程,包括以下几个关键知识点: 1. **主控芯片选择**:使用EP2C5T144C8N作为主控芯片,这是一款Cyclone II系列的FPGA,具有较高的逻辑资源和I/O接口能力,适合驱动复杂的LED点阵显示屏。 2. **硬件设计**:点阵LED显示屏由4块8×8点阵LED模块组合而成,形成16×16的显示模式。硬件设计包括行驱动器74HC154和列驱动器74HC595,它们负责控制LED矩阵的开关状态,以实现显示内容的更新。 3. **动态显示技术**:为了提高显示效果和效率,论文采用了动态显示技术。这意味着不是一次性点亮所有LED,而是分时复用每一行或每一列,使得视觉上看起来所有像素都在同时显示,降低了硬件需求,也节省了电力。 4. **软件程序设计**:控制系统程序在FPGA中编写,通过编程控制LED的阳极和阴极端的电压,决定各个显示点的亮灭。这通常涉及到硬件描述语言(如VHDL或Verilog)的使用,编写代码来定义LED的驱动逻辑。 5. **字符点阵数据**:显示的字符或图形可以通过两种方式生成:直接编写点阵数据(手动画图)或从标准字库中提取。点阵数据决定了每个字符或图形在点阵屏上的像素布局。 6. **应用领域**:LED点阵显示屏因其灵活性、稳定性、低功耗、长寿命和成本效益,在众多场景中广泛应用,如车站信息显示、证券交易所、体育场馆、交通指示、室内/室外信息公告等。 7. **系统性能**:设计结果表明,该系统性能稳定,结构设计合理,还具备横向扩展功能,可以方便地拼接多个单元以扩大显示面积。 通过这篇毕业论文,读者不仅可以了解到基于FPGA的LED点阵显示屏设计的基本原理和技术,还能深入理解到硬件设计和软件编程在实际应用中的具体实践。
剩余48页未读,继续阅读
- 粉丝: 2730
- 资源: 8万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助